Handover note — Crumbwheel order cutoffs.

Welcome aboard. The bakery cutoff rule in Crumbwheel closes same-day orders at 14:00 local to each storefront, not UTC — this has bitten us twice. Holiday overrides live in the calendar service and take precedence silently, so always check there first when a cutoff looks wrong. To unlock the calendar service's admin console after a restart, enter the recovery passphrase below.

vault phrase of bagap-bahaf = silion-pelox-sorox-casdor-quenwyn-fraax-eliox-praael-kelion-quenvan-kasox-rusael-norius-belvan

Checklist item 7 — Spoolhound cutover. Before approving, make sure the Spoolhound printer-spooler service drains its job queue on SIGTERM instead of dropping pending jobs; we got burned on that in the Larkfield rollout. Also eyeball the retry backoff config — it should cap at two minutes, not grow forever. Once both look sane, kick off the staging smoke print and wait for green. Then stamp the review with the build token printed directly below this line.

build token for haduf-bafog: htk21_2d98ce91a83676b65394a

## Build Agent Clock Skew

Agents in the Vorell pool sync against the internal Hestrad time source every 90 seconds. Skew above 2s fails attestation and the build is quarantined. Review the skew log before approving any override. Overrides are authorized per-agent and require the attestation token set in the agent's environment. Append this line to agent.env:

vault entry, yajop-bafop: ARCHIVE_KEY3=8d4

Checklist Item 7 — Off-site Run, Quarterly Stock-Count Ledger

The bound quarterly stock-count ledger for Thornmere Supply goes to the Aldwick records office on this run. Place it in the grey document case, clasp locked, and log the departure time on the run sheet. The ledger is the only original copy, so it must not be left unattended in the vehicle at any stop. Dispatch desk confirms the route with the driver before departure. The instruction for the courier hand-over reads:

handover note for yagef-bagep: the drudor pelius courier leaves the kasdor zorvan norir ledger at gate 8016 under passcode 755406